Permitted Acquisitions and Permitted Joint Ventures Sample Clauses

Permitted Acquisitions and Permitted Joint Ventures amend the credit agreement (i) to delete paragraphs (b)(i) and (b)(ii) of each of the definition of Permitted Acquisition and the definition of Permitted Joint Venture and to add a condition that the business of the acquired entity or the business acquired, as the case may be, is substantially of the same nature as that set out in the definition of Business, (ii) increase the de minimis threshold in paragraph (b)(iv) of each of the definition of Permitted Acquisition and the definition of Permitted Joint Venture to refer to €250,000,000 as the threshold amount rather than €40,000,000 (but excluding from the Acquisition Cost for these purposes any consideration to be paid in cash other than the proceeds of a Utilisation of an Additional Facility or any other incurrence of debt that ranks pari passu in right of payment with the Facilities under the Intercreditor Agreement as amended) and to extend the period of time for UPC Broadband to deliver the relevant certificate to the Facility Agent from 15 to 60 days and (iii) delete Clause 4.4 (Deferred Acquisition Costs).

  • Permitted Acquisitions (a) Subject to the provisions of this Section 9.14 and the requirements contained in the definition of Permitted Acquisition, the Borrower and any of its Wholly-Owned Subsidiaries may from time to time effect Permitted Acquisitions, so long as (in each case except to the extent the Required Lenders otherwise specifically agree in writing in the case of a specific Permitted Acquisition): (i) no Default, Event of Default or Compliance Period shall be in existence at the time of the consummation of the proposed Permitted Acquisition or immediately after giving effect thereto; (ii) the Borrower shall have given the Administrative Agent (on behalf of the Lenders) at least 10 Business Days’ prior written notice of the proposed Permitted Acquisition; (iii) all representations and warranties contained herein and in the other Credit Documents shall be true and correct in all material respects with the same effect as though such representations and warranties had been made on and as of the date of such Permitted Acquisition (both before and after giving effect thereto), unless stated to relate to a specific earlier date, in which case such representations and warranties shall be true and correct in all material respects as of such earlier date; (iv) the Borrower provides to the Administrative Agent (on behalf of the Lenders) as soon as available but not later than 5 Business Days after the execution thereof, a copy of any executed purchase agreement or similar agreement with respect to such Permitted Acquisition; (v) after giving effect to such Permitted Acquisition and the payment of all post-closing purchase price adjustments required (in the good faith determination of the Borrower) in connection with such Permitted Acquisition (and all other Permitted Acquisitions for which such purchase price adjustments may be required to be made) and all capital expenditures (and the financing thereof) reasonably anticipated by the Borrower to be made in the business acquired pursuant to such Permitted Acquisition within the 180-day period (such period for any Permitted Acquisition, a “Post-Closing Period”) following such Permitted Acquisition (and in the businesses acquired pursuant to all other Permitted Acquisitions with Post-Closing Periods ended during the Post-Closing Period of such Permitted Acquisition), there shall exist no Compliance Period; (vi) such proposed Permitted Acquisition shall be effected in accordance with the relevant requirements of Section 9.17; (vii) the Borrower determines in good faith that the Borrower and its Subsidiaries taken as a whole are not likely to assume or become liable for material increased contingent liabilities as a result of such proposed Permitted Acquisition (excluding, however, Indebtedness permitted to be incurred pursuant to Section 10.04 in connection therewith); (viii) substantially all of the Acquired Entity or Business acquired pursuant to the respective Permitted Acquisition is in a Qualified Jurisdiction, provided, however, the respective proposed Permitted Acquisition shall not be required to meet the requirements set forth above in this clause (viii) if the Maximum Permitted Consideration payable in connection with such Permitted Acquisition, when aggregated with the Maximum Permitted Consideration payable in connection with all other Permitted Acquisitions consummated after the Initial Borrowing Date in which all or substantially all of the Acquired Entity or Business so acquired were not in Qualified Jurisdictions, does not exceed $300,000,000; and (ix) the Borrower shall have delivered to the Administrative Agent on the date of the consummation of such proposed Permitted Acquisition, an officer’s certificate executed by an Authorized Officer of the Borrower, certifying to the best of his knowledge, compliance with the requirements of preceding clauses (i) through (iii), inclusive, and clauses (v) through (viii), inclusive, and containing the calculations required by the preceding clauses (iii) and (viii).

  • Existing Indebtedness (a) Except as described therein, Schedule 5.15 sets forth a complete and correct list of all outstanding Indebtedness of the Company as of March 31, 2014 (including a description of the obligors and obligees, principal amount outstanding and collateral therefor, if any, and Guaranty thereof, if any), since which date there has been no Material change in the amounts, interest rates, sinking funds, installment payments or maturities of the Indebtedness of the Company. The Company is not in default and no waiver of default is currently in effect, in the payment of any principal or interest on any Indebtedness of the Company and no event or condition exists with respect to any Indebtedness of the Company the outstanding principal amount of which exceeds $5,000,000 that would permit (or that with notice or the lapse of time, or both, would permit) one or more Persons to cause such Indebtedness to become due and payable before its stated maturity or before its regularly scheduled dates of payment.
